Historical Performance

When we talk about historical performance, both the Trail Blazers and the Jazz have carved out impressive legacies in the NBA. The Portland Trail Blazers, for example, clinched their NBA championship title in 1977, a moment etched in the memories of their fans. They've also boasted legendary players like Clyde Drexler, who led the team to multiple playoff appearances. Thinking about those golden years really brings a sense of nostalgia, doesn't it? On the other side, the Utah Jazz, while never winning a championship, have been a consistent force in the Western Conference. They had their own iconic duo in John Stockton and Karl Malone, who orchestrated some of the most memorable pick-and-roll plays in NBA history. Their consistent playoff runs during the 90s are stuff of legends. Comparing their historical journeys, it’s clear that both teams have had eras of dominance and periods of rebuilding. The Blazers' championship win gives them a slight edge in terms of ultimate success, but the Jazz’s sustained excellence over the years can’t be ignored. Key Moments in History

Let’s zoom in on some key moments in the history of each team. For the Trail Blazers, that 1977 championship run stands out like a beacon. The team, led by Bill Walton, showcased incredible teamwork and resilience, capturing the hearts of fans in Portland and beyond. Fast forward to the Clyde Drexler era, and you see a team that was always in contention, battling against powerhouses like the Chicago Bulls. For the Jazz, the Stockton-to-Malone era was a masterclass in consistency. They reached the NBA Finals twice in the late 90s, only to be thwarted by Michael Jordan’s Bulls. Though they never got the ring, their journey was filled with unforgettable moments and nail-biting games. Team Strengths and Weaknesses

Let's dive into the team strengths and weaknesses of both the Trail Blazers and the Jazz. The Trail Blazers, known for their offensive firepower, can score with the best of them. Their strength lies in their dynamic backcourt and their ability to shoot the lights out from beyond the arc. However, their defense has often been a point of concern, and consistency can be an issue at times. They can look unstoppable one night and struggle the next. On the other hand, the Jazz have built their identity on defense, with Rudy Gobert patrolling the paint and deterring opponents from attacking the rim. Their structured offense and ball movement make them tough to guard, but sometimes they can lack that go-to scorer in crunch time.
